Anyone had any luck haggling O2 on their SIM-only deal?
Just spoke to O2 as they have raised my charges £13.10/month for 20GB/month (unlimited texts/calls). Technically it's 40GB/month because of my Virgin Media package.
Tesco Mobile have their £12.50/month (with clubcard) offer which offers the same package but 60GB/month. O2 said Tesco's offer was a "fantastic deal" (there words not mine) and they couldn't match it (they offered to put me on an upgrade that would increase the price to £15/month for 50GB). They couldn't even match it with Volt.
I said I would leave for Tesco and they basically just asked if I wanted my PAC code
.

Although it's not exactly the same network as O2 they do rent off of the same infrastructure and they cover all the areas I go to. Should I just go for Tesco or go for round 2 of haggling O2?

As long as you are happy with slower 4G speeds, no 4G calling or Wifi calling then Tesco may be suitable.
Unless things have changed they do not offer some of the things you may be taking for granted being on O2.0 -

As above go via USwitch and see if you can get a better deal if you wish to stay with o2.
You dont even need to port your number. I swapped to the same 4GB plan (only cheaper by £1)/ month ) by going through Uswitch. It simply asks are you an existing O2 customer, when you say yes its moves you to the new tariff within 24 hrs. You dont even get a new SIM.2 -
